import { Vec3 } from '@quake2ts/shared'; export declare enum DemoCameraMode { FirstPerson = 0, ThirdPerson = 1, Free = 2, Follow = 3 } export interface DemoCameraState { mode: DemoCameraMode; thirdPersonDistance: number; thirdPersonOffset: Vec3; freeCameraOrigin: Vec3; freeCameraAngles: Vec3; followEntityId: number; currentFollowOrigin?: Vec3; } //# sourceMappingURL=camera.d.ts.map